Research Abstract

Understanding of electronic structure near the Fermi level of electronic devices under operation is important from the view point of both basic and applied sciences. However, it is quite difficult in the precise observation of the electronic structure under the device operation due to the presence of electrodes and applied electronic fields. In this research project, we have developed the operand electronic structure analysis system based on the soft X-ray emission spectroscopy.
